Understanding tasting notes opens the secrets hidden within each sip, allowing you to savour the nuanced characteristics that make red wine so exceptional.
When sampling red wine, pay attention to fragrance. Do you detect traces of vanilla? Perhaps a touch of oak? These aromatic clues weave together to create the initial impression.
Subsequently, consider the taste. Is it robust? Or subtler? Does it remain on your tongue, leaving a prolonged impression?
- Robust red wines often have concentrated flavors of dark fruit, spices, and sometimes leathery notes.
- Subtle red wines may showcase cherries, herbal nuances, and a refreshing finish.
Combining your red wine with the right food can elevate both experiences to new heights. Think about the weight of the wine and the dish – a full-bodied red pairs well with meaty meals, while a softer red complements seafood.
Enhance Your Wine Journey: Mastering the Choice of Glassware
A well-chosen wine glass can dramatically transform your tasting experience. It's not just about aesthetics; the shape and size of a glass directly influence how aromas are released and flavors interact on your palate. Consider the type of wine you'll be indulging in. A full-bodied red, for example, benefits from a larger bowl to allow for proper aeration, while a crisp white wine is best enjoyed in a narrower glass that concentrates its aromas.
- Consider a stemmed glass for optimal swirling and temperature control.
- Pay attention to the glass's rim - a wider rim can concentrate or diffuse aromas depending on your preference.
- Explore different shapes and sizes to find what best complements your favorite wines.

Uncork Your Senses: Your Guide to Wine Tasting
Dive into the captivating world of wine with our comprehensive guide. Every sip offers a unique tapestry of flavors, aromas, and sensations, waiting to be explored. Whether you're a seasoned connoisseur or a curious beginner, this journey will ignite your appreciation for the art of wine tasting.
Embark by selecting a variety of wines with distinct characteristics. Red, white, sparkling: each style offers its own distinct profile to tantalize your palate.
Consider the following factors to guide your tasting experience:
* **Sight:** Observe the wine's color and clarity. Does it gleam?
* **Smell:** Inhale deeply, appreciating the bouquet of aromas. Do you detect fruits, spices, or floral notes?
* **Taste:** Take a small sip, allowing the wine to coat across your tongue. Pay attention to its body, acidity, tannins, and finish. Describe the dominant flavors and lingering sensations.
Share your observations with fellow pals and engage in lively discussions about the nuances of each wine. Remember, there's no right or wrong way to taste; let your senses guide you on this delightful adventure.
